    It was working on Debian 11, but after upgrading to Debian 12 just calling the program make it crash:

    root@davis:~# cpu
    CPU_loadLibrary: dlopen(libcpu_ldap.so, RTLD_NOW) failed.
    CPU_loadLibrary: /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libcpu_ldap.so: undefined symbol: globalLdap
    There was an error loading the ldap library. Exiting.
